What is the slope of the line that passes through the points (-6,-8)and (-14,4) write your answer in simplest form.

Slope = (y2-y1) / (x2-x1)
Therefore:
m = (4 - (-8)) / (-14 - (-6))
m = 12 / -8
m = - 3/2
